Brenda Gannon is a scholar working on General Health Professions, Economics and Econometrics and Demography. According to data from OpenAlex, Brenda Gannon has authored 70 papers receiving a total of 1.2k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 36 papers in General Health Professions, 26 papers in Economics and Econometrics and 19 papers in Demography. Recurrent topics in Brenda Gannon’s work include Retirement, Disability, and Employment (16 papers), Global Health Care Issues (14 papers) and Health disparities and outcomes (12 papers). Brenda Gannon is often cited by papers focused on Retirement, Disability, and Employment (16 papers), Global Health Care Issues (14 papers) and Health disparities and outcomes (12 papers). Brenda Gannon collaborates with scholars based in Australia, United Kingdom and Ireland. Brenda Gannon's co-authors include Brian Nolan, Jennifer Roberts, Eamon O’Shea, John Cullinan, Bengt Winblad, Anders Wimo, Linus Jönsson, Ming‐Ann Hsu, Anders Gustavsson and Anton Pak and has published in prestigious journals such as Social Science & Medicine, Annals of the Rheumatic Diseases and BMC Public Health.
